Karuna are looking for volunteers to join them for their telephone appeal, based in the Karuna office in North London as part of this year's Buddhist Action Month.
Karuna works to end caste-based discrimination, poverty and inequality in India and Nepal. By providing tools, skills and support to grassroots organisations, Karuna can create community champions and build local networks. These networks then spread, benefiting even more people and sustaining the cycle of transformation. You can watch the short video to see more about Karuna's work.
